Simple to use

Washer dryer combos are known as all in one laundry machines, and are ideal for small spaces. They combine the functions of a washing machine and dryer in one unit. They are ideal in small apartments mobile homes, RVs, or even mobile homes. These units are easy to use and don't require switching between appliances. This means that you can simply place your laundry in the washer, turn it on, and let it perform its task while you're away.

The best washer dryer combinations have a number of features that make them easy to use. They have a built in water heater that regulates the temperature of the water used to wash. A spin cycle removes excess moisture, making it easier for dryers to dry clothes. Some have a specific vibration reduction technology to cut the shuddering sound that are typically associated with dryers and washers. They also offer a variety of wash cycles that are different and five temperature settings that you can choose from. They are particularly beneficial for people with mobility issues, as they don't have to worry about transporting the load from the washer to the dryer.

A combo washer dryer has a smaller drum than a standalone washing machine, and this can limit the amount laundry you can wash at once. However, it is sufficient for the majority of small families. This type of appliance comes with certain drawbacks. It is costly to purchase and run. Second, you cannot wash more loads while the previous cycle is still running. This could be a problem for people who do a lot of laundry. Finally, these appliances can be more complicated and more likely break down than standalone washing machines.

Another drawback of this kind of device is its large water consumption when drying. This can be an issue if you live on tank water or are concerned about the environment. If you have an extensive family you might want to consider a separate washer/dryer. If you're planning to move in the near future, you might be better off with an ordinary washer and dryer set.

Drying takes longer

Washer dryers are ideal for those who need to reduce space in small homes, apartments, condos or. These machines combine two machines in one cabinet. This allows you to wash and dry your clothes at the same. However, they will take longer to complete a full cycle than standalone dryers and washers and dryers combo. A combination unit could take between three and six hours to complete a wash and dry. This can be a problem for those who do a significant amount of laundry but have a limited amount of free time.

The primary reason why washer dryer combos run longer than conventional dryers is that the tub's temperature increases when the drying process begins. This means that it takes longer for air in the drum of the machine to cool and condense into water. In dryers the use of cold air is typically used to cool the process however, in washer dryer combo units, hot water is used instead.

In addition to taking longer drying, washer and dryer machine combination also uses more energy to accomplish the same task as a regular dryer. This can result in a significant increase to your monthly utility bill if utilize the unit to perform more than one load at a time.

A second disadvantage of washer-dryer machines is that they are smaller in capacity. They can only hold 1.5-5 cubic feet, which is less than what a traditional dryer or washing machine can handle.
